You are on the right track with expanding all 3 equations.

Do the same for all three equations:

    (1) 254 = ab^2 + cb + d
    (2) 330 = a(b+1)^2 + c(b+1) + d
    (3) 416 = a(b+2)^2 + c(b+2) + d

Note that d is a common term in all the equations - can you find a way to get rid of it, so you have 3 equations with 3 unknowns?
